Publisher's Summary

From YouTube star and Facebook Video sensation Laura Clery comes a collection of comedic essays in the vein of We Are Never Meeting in Real Life by Samantha Irby and You’ll Grow Out of It by Jessi Klein.

Laura Clery makes a living by sharing inappropriate comedy sketches with millions of strangers on the internet. She writes songs about her anatomy, talks trash about her one-eyed rescue pug, and sexually harasses her husband, Stephen. And it pays the bills!

Now, in her first-ever audiobook, Laura recounts how she went from being a dangerously impulsive, broke, unemployable, suicidal, cocaine-addicted narcissist, crippled by fear and hopping from one toxic romance to the next...to a more-happy-than-not, somewhat rational, meditating, vegan yogi with good credit, a great marriage, a fantastic career, and four unfortunate-looking rescue animals. Still, above all, Laura remains an amazingly talented, adorable, and vulnerable self-described...Idiot.

With her signature brand of offbeat, no-holds-barred humor, Idiot introduces you to a wildly original - and undeniably relatable - new voice.

Editorial Review

Discover how Laura Clery overcame poverty, lack of skills, and a cocaine addiction to thrive as a successful married woman who adopts rescue animals, practices yoga, and maintains a vegan lifestyle.

Idiot is a collection of essays on how Laura Clery traded in her old life for a new one. Her accounts go into gritty but frank details about everything from addiction to domestic violence. Yet somehow she manages to find the humour in every situation and shares her stories in a relatable, inspiring way.

To add to the realness of Idiot, this Audible audiobook is narrated by Laura Clery herself. With a clear voice and chatty, upbeat tone, Laura’s narration is less like a performance and more like hearing a friend share shocking but side-splittingly funny stories about her life over a coffee.

Yet Idiot is not Laura’s first brush with acclaim. Prior to creating this title, she built up a following by posting comedy sketches on Facebook and YouTube every day. All told, she has over two billion views and millions of followers.

Within just months of Idiot’s release date, Clery was nominated for an Audie Award in the Humor category. This title maintains impressively high ratings and has become a favourite for many.

Standing Ovation!

This audiobook is excellent in every single way. Laura Clery is an incredible writer, performer and narrator of her story. She uses character voices, accents, tonal range and everything in between to keep you fully invested in her story.
Usually, I find it difficult to fall in love with audiobooks, because if the narration doesn’t sound natural, I immediately lose attention. Laura nailed it. I’ve never read.. or listened.. to a story so quickly in my life.
Apart from her incredible performance in narration, Laura is humourous in a wonderful self-deprecating way that almost anyone could relate to, even if her personal experiences are not at all relatable. She tells it as it is, no sugar coating to anything, and it’s truly riveting.
Throughout listening, Laura took me on a rollercoaster of emotions as she told me the ups and downs through her struggle with addictions and her aspirations of becoming an actress. I felt heart wrenched, scared, surprised, shocked, excited, inspired, and so many more emotions all within a few hours of listening.
I already can’t wait to read her second book, Idiots… In fact, I’m going to purchase it right now.
